A second-order convergent and linearized difference schemefor the initial-boundary value problemof the Korteweg-de Vries equation 被引量:1

To numerically solve the initial-boundary value problem of the Korteweg-de Vries equation,an equivalent coupled system of nonlinear equations is obtained by the method of reduction of order.Then,a difference scheme is constructed for the system.The new variable introduced can be separated from the difference scheme to obtain another difference scheme containing only the original variable.The energy method is applied to the theoretical analysis of the difference scheme.Results show that the difference scheme is uniquely solvable and satisfies the energy conservation law corresponding to the original problem.Moreover,the difference scheme converges when the step ratio satisfies a constraint condition,and the temporal and spatial convergence orders are both two.Numerical examples verify the convergence order and the invariant of the difference scheme.Furthermore,the step ratio constraint is unnecessary for the convergence of the difference scheme.Compared with a known two-level nonlinear difference scheme,the proposed difference scheme has more advantages in numerical calculation. 展开更多

UNIFORM DIFFERENCE SCHEME FOR A SINGULARLY PERTURBED LINEAR 2ND ORDER HYPERBOLIC PROBLEM WITH ZEROTH ORDER REDUCED EQUATION

In this paper a singularly perturbed linear second order hyperbolic problem with zeroth order reduced equation is discussed. Firstly, an energy inequality of the solution and an estimate of the remainder term of the asymptotic solution are given. Then an exponentially fitted difference scheme is developed in an equidistant mesh. Finally, uniform convergence in small parameter is proved in the sense of discrete energy norm. 展开更多

Convergence of a Linearized and Conservative Difference Scheme for the Klein-Gordon-Zakharov Equation

A linearized and conservative finite difference scheme is presented for the initial-boundary value problem of the Klein-Gordon-Zakharov (KGZ) equation. The new scheme is also decoupled in computation, which means that no iteration is needed and parallel computation can be used, so it is expected to be more efficient in imple- mentation. The existence of the difference solution is proved by Browder fixed point theorem. Besides the standard energy method, in order to overcome the difficulty in obtaining a priori estimate, an induction argument is used to prove that the new scheme is uniquely solvable and second order convergent for U in the discrete L∞- norm, and for N in the discrete L2-norm, respectively, where U and N are the numeri- cal solutions of the KGZ equation. Numerical results verify the theoretical analysis. 展开更多

On The Numerical Solution of Two Dimensional Model of an Alloy Solidification Problem

In this paper, a linearized three level difference scheme is derived for two-dimensional model of an alloy solidification problem called Sivashinsky equation. Further, it is proved that the scheme is uniquely solvable and convergent with convergence rate of order two in a discrete L<sup>∞</sup>-norm. At last, numerical experiments are carried out to support the theoretical claims. 展开更多
